 PRHS Expansion Continues to Roll Forward 

Architect Rendering

Rendering by Eckles Architecture

The Pine-Richland High School expansion project continues to progress.  The most outwardly visible work is being done on the parking lot.

 

Site work on that will continue throughout the summer. The high school campus and PR Administrative Offices are closed to the public this summer.  


Crews are: 

  • Finishing up utility work on the site  
  • Progressing on pond work on the site
  • Excavating the ground in the parking lot
  • Prepping ground to put asphalt in place on parking lot.

Other work that's not so visible includes:   

  • Steel work continues in back of high school
  • Demolition work complete on Large Group Instruction Room & guidance area
  • Drywall finished in kitchen
  • Plumbing plans in place & duct work in progress for kitchen
  • PRHS administration & main data room area demolition in progress

The district has implemented a 2011-2012 start date of Sept. 6, 2011 to give crews time to ready the campus for the arrival of students. The project will have minimal impact on student operations.

This summer, however: 

  • The PRHS Campus, Pool & PR Administrative Offices are closed to the public. The district is hosting special enrollment hours for new, incoming students. Click here for details.    
  •  The summer programs at the PRHS Stadium can be accessed via the Logan Road Entrance.  
  • The board meetings in July & August will be held in the Eden Hall Upper Elementary Campus Large Group Instruction Room, 3900 Bakerstown Rd. in Gibsonia.
